coal Students Britannica Kids Homework Help

The final step in surface coal extraction is reclamation of the mined site. Reclamation is required by both federal and state law and has, since the middle of the 20th century, become a standard and integral part of modern coal-mining operations. The reclamation process actually begins before the first ton of coal is removed.احصل على السعر

Fact Sheet Series U.S. Environmental Protection Agency

202343  Acid mine drainage can be a problem at coal mining operations in certain areas. In general, the problems of acid mine drainage are confined to western Maryland, northern West Virginia, Pennsylvania, western Kentucky, and along the Illinois -Indiana border.
